Notable Questions
- #13: Took me a while; need to keep practicing Burnside's lemma/technique. (note to self: revisit topic & drill)
- #22: Became a time sink. Pause sooner; sketch structure, estimate difficulty, and decide quickly whether to skip.
- #24: Didn’t understand the question—unclear how to set up the average. Re-read carefully; translate wording to variables first.
- #25: Ran out of time.
Process & Timing Notes
- Not enough time at the end—was able to draw the diagram but didn’t complete the setup.
- For average/setup questions: define variables immediately, write the equation before computing.
- When a problem starts ballooning (>3–4 minutes without structure), mark and move.

Here are the basics:
If two triangles are similar, their corresponding angles are congruent and their corresponding sides will have the same ratio or proportion.
Δ ABC and ΔDEF are similar.
\(\frac{AB}{DE}\) = \(\frac{AC}{DF}\) = \(\frac{BC}{EF}\)= their height ratio = their perimeter ratio.
Once you know the linear ratio, you can just square the linear ratio to get the area ratio and cube the linear ratio to get the volume ratio.
Once you know the linear ratio, you can just square the linear ratio to get the area ratio and cube the linear ratio to get the volume ratio.
